

At a desert diner, the lives of five strangers become linked through a single twenty-dollar bill. Shot for $20,000 and starring Philip Baker Hall, the short premiered at Sundance and later inspired Anderson’s debut feature Hard Eight (1996).

The production budget was $20.0K.
The film was directed by Paul Thomas Anderson.
The screenplay was written by Paul Thomas Anderson.
Cinematography was handled by Vincent Baldino.
